I tried the GTI stalk on my Vanagon, and it does fit...but it is shorter and at a different angle. While I did get used to it, it wasn't as ergonomic as the stock stalk :) Had the idea (similar to Philippe) of using the MFA from an '84 GTI in my Vanagon. Thought I could build it into the centre of the dash below the LED cluster. I got as far as pinning out the GTI foil circuitry, obtaining an outside temp sensor (turned out to be Celsius, the MFA was a US model and expected Fahrenheit), and then other things came up and...well its still in a drawer in the garage. I did install the tach from the GTI though. Alistair
